Understanding SCHD: An Overview
Before diving into the calculator, it's important initially to comprehend what SCHD is. The Schwab U.S. Dividend Equity ETF intends to track the efficiency of the Dow Jones U.S. Dividend 100 Index, concentrating on high dividend yielding U.S. stocks defined by solid fundamentals.
Key Features of SCHD:Expense Ratio: Low-cost alternative with an expenditure ratio of 0.06%, making it appealing for long-term financiers.Dividend Yield: Historically strong dividend yields, often above the market average.Diversification: Invests in various sectors, consisting of innovation, healthcare, durable goods, and monetary services.Tax Efficiency: The fund has tax-efficient strategies, supplying a benefit for taxable accounts.Why Use a Quarterly Dividend Calculator?

Determining dividends from SCHD can be done utilizing a simple formula:
Dividend Calculation Formula:
[\ text Quarterly Dividend Income = (\ text Shares Owned) \ times (\ text Dividend per Share)]Step-by-Step Guide:Determine the Number of Shares Owned: This is the total number of shares you have in SCHD.Discover the most recent Dividend Payment: Check the most recent dividend per share. This data is normally available on finance sites, or directly from Schwab's page.Use the Formula: Multiply the variety of shares by the dividend per share.Review Quarterly vs. Annual Dividends: Multiply the result by 4 for an annual estimate if wanted.Example Calculation:Shares OwnedDividend per ShareQuarterly Dividend Income100₤ 0.50(100 \ times 0.50 = 50)200₤ 0.50(200 \ times 0.50 = 100)150₤ 0.50(150 \ times 0.50 = 75)
Using the example above, an investor owning 100 shares of SCHD would make a quarterly dividend of ₤ 50.

Q1: How typically does SCHD pay dividends?A: SCHD pays dividends quarterly, usually in March, June, September, and December.

Q2: Can I reinvest my dividends?A: Yes, numerous brokerage firms offer a Dividend Reinvestment Plan(DRIP )enabling dividends to be reinvested to acquire extra shares. Q3: What is the historical dividend yield for SCHD?A:

Historically, SCHD's dividend yield has actually been around 3-4%
